[D23 EXPO] Disney Music Emporium Pop-Up Store Returns, Features Artists & Composers

Disney Music Emporium returns to D23 Expo 2019 with a pop-up store on the show floor, featuring new releases, album signings, and classic Disney music merchandise. Of the 23 new music products available at the Expo, ten titles are especially noted, including: Avengers: Endgame (12” picture disc), Aladdin: The Songs (vinyl album), “I Just Can’t Wait to Be King” (12” vinyl single from The Lion King), “Star Wars: Galaxy’s Edge Symphonic Suite” (12” picture disc),  “Married Life”/”Carl Goes Up” (12” vinyl from Up), The Princess and the Frog: The Songs (12” picture disc), and “The Sorcerer’s Apprentice” (12” single from Fantasia).

In addition to various merchandise (including vinyls, cassettes, and posters) and the opportunity to pre-order the upcoming Matthew Morrison Disney album, fans will also be treated to several album signing opportunities. Artists include Disney Legend Randy Newman (Toy Story), composer Tyler Bates (Guardians of the Galaxy Vol 1 and Vol 2), actor Anthony Gonzalez (Coco‘s Miguel), singer-songwriter-actor Matthew Morrison (Glee), and artist JD McCrary (young Simba in The Lion King).

As reported earlier this month, Disney Music Group’s supervising producer and music historian Randy Thornton will present “Great Moments with Walt Disney” at the Archives stage on Friday, August 23, at 10:30 AM. The presentation will include real audio recordings of Disney himself as he recalls developing the first cartoon with synchronized sound, and other moments, like creating the film studio’s first hit song.
